Fashion's Transformation

Each decade reveals a unique collection of trends that capture the zeitgeist. The roaring twenties were all about opulence, with flapper dresses and cloche hats taking center stage. The fifties brought gracefulness, as poodle skirts and saddle shoes dominated the streets.

Fast forward to the seventies, and we see a rebellious vibe emerge, with bell bottoms, platform shoes, and tie-dye taking over. The eighties were all about drama, featuring power suits, leggings, and neon colors. And then there's the nineties, a decade of grunge and minimalism, with ripped jeans, oversized flannels, and slip dresses defining the era. Each decade tells its own story, leaving a lasting impact on fashion history.

The Power Suit: A Legacy of Female Empowerment

The female icon has become a symbol of strength and achievement for women in the professional world. Originating in the late 20th century, it quickly became associated with female leadership. Women who donned this sharp and structured look were often seen as competent, ready to take on any challenge. The suit wasn't just about the fabric; it was a statement, a visual representation of women carving out their space in traditionally male-dominated fields.

This legacy continues to this day. While styles have evolved and diversified, the core message remains: a woman in a suit is a force to be reckoned with. It's a reminder of progress made and a testament to the ongoing fight for equality in the workplace.
